How to Make Simple Strawberry Sorbet

  1. Freeze 1 pound of fresh strawberries for at least 2 hours, or until solid.
  2. Place the frozen strawberries and 1/2 cup granulated sugar into a food processor. Pulse until the strawberries are finely chopped.
  3. Add 1/4 cup of water to the food processor and blend until completely smooth and creamy.
  4. Transfer the mixture to a freezer-safe container. Freeze for at least 2 hours, or until firm enough to scoop. Stir every 30 minutes to prevent large ice crystals from forming.
  5. Enjoy your homemade strawberry sorbet!
